About Yung Lean
Jonathan Leandoer Hastad, professionally known as Yung Lean is a Swedish rapper, record producer and singer-songwriter who gained fame after his 2013 track, Gingseng Strip 2002 went viral on YouTube.
He released his debut studio album titled Unknown Memory and his first mixtape, Unknown Death 2002 in 2013.
His second mixtape, Frost God, as well as his second studio album titled Warlord were released in 2016.
Family Life
His father, Kristoffer Leandoer is a poet, translator and fantasy author, while his mother, Elsa Hastad is an LGBT human rights activist. He is the grandson of British-Jewish playwright, Arnold Wesker.
Achievements
In 2014, he was included in XXL Magazine’s list of “15 European Rappers You Should Know”.
He was honored with the Bram Stoker Medal of Cultural Achievement by the University Philosophical Society at Trinity College in 2019.
Trivia
Yung Lean has cited the likes of Nas’s IIImatic, Mitt Kvarter by The Latin Kings, and 50 Cent’s Get Rich or Die Tryin’ as his early hip hop influences.
He was placed on probation at age 15 for smoking cannabis.
He has a wide range of hobbies including painting, playing the piano, reading and writing.
In 2016, he was diagnosed with bipolar disorder.
